Output a3a6f5bdff136e8a10061db53980c54f2836a9a820d15181746826ca1f7304b2:0

value
23102341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50580f38579cff430e8ffe8cd182c8366e1979f8 OP_EQUAL
address
391qUNK99yYCuxWyZotfkaemTdvNbfDKmz
transaction
a3a6f5bdff136e8a10061db53980c54f2836a9a820d15181746826ca1f7304b2
confirmations
390545
spent
true